Negombo
Negombo, a vibrant coastal city in Gampaha, Sri Lanka, is a traveler's paradise. With its stunning beaches, bustling markets, and rich history, Negombo offers an unforgettable experience. The city's sandy shores are perfect for swimming, surfing, and sunbathing, while its lagoon is ideal for boating and fishing. The Dutch Canal, built during the colonial era, adds to the city's charm, and visitors can take a boat ride to explore the waterway. Negombo's fish market is a must-see attraction, where visitors can witness the hustle and bustle of fishermen selling their catch of the day. The city's colonial past is reflected in its architecture, with beautiful churches and buildings that showcase its history. Negombo also boasts a vibrant nightlife, with bars and restaurants that offer a range of cuisines, from traditional Sri Lankan to international. For those seeking a spiritual experience, the Angurukaramulla Temple and St. Mary's Church are popular destinations. Negombo is also a great base for exploring nearby attractions, such as the Muthurajawela Wetlands and the ancient city of Anuradhapura.
